That being said, CrossFit is only ONE hour of your day. I know Coach Michael has said this before but I think it is a good point to be reiterated. If you’re not a “CrossFitter” the other 23 hours of the day than you’re not going to see the most out of your experience with us. So, what does a “CrossFitter” do?
The key is in the recovery! During the rest of your day, try recovering from your hardcore WODs by getting enough water, refueling with proper nutrition, having a healthy positive mindset, finding plenty of restful sleep, mobilizing/stretching, and getting overall life enjoyment. Don’t let your lifestyle cancel out the amazing work you are putting in at the gym. Use that one hour per day to motivate you to spread the “healthy” to the rest of your life. The act of CrossFit alone cannot change your life, you must use it to make an active change for the better in everything you do.
If you’ve been feeling like results aren't there or that you’re not improving, take a second to analyze the way you are living. See the list above and ask yourself how those things are going for ya! PLEASE remember that YOU going to CrossFit is a BIG first step but it is only one foot into the success of your journey. WOD
"Jackie"
1000m row
50 EB thrusters
30 pull-ups
